Breaking Boundaries is a captivating feature-length documentary that follows the journey of Nastasya Generalova, a determined black Californian teenager raised by her single white Russian mother, Olga. Enrolled in rhythmic gymnastics at the age of four to connect with her mother's homeland, Nastasya faces systemic biases and limited resources as the only black girl in Team USA. As she strives to become the first African-American rhythmic gymnast from the USA to compete in the 2020 Olympic Games, the film delves into the emotional and physical challenges she encounters, highlighting her resilience, ambition, and the unwavering support of her mother. This poignant story offers a unique perspective on racial diversity and the personal struggles of breaking boundaries in a predominantly white sport.
